Two million years ago, enormous creatures -- nine-foot flightless birds, giant seventeen-foot beavers, predatory marsupial lions as tall as elephants -- roamed Earth in huge numbers ... and then mysteriously went extinct. This program explores possible explanations put forward by scientists from Patagonia to Colorado to New Zealand: profound climatic change, inability of large animals to adapt to a changing environment, a killer virus, or wholesale...

If we and the rest of the backboned animals were to disappear overnight, the rest of the world would get on pretty well. But if they were to disappear, the land's ecosystems would collapse. The soil would lose its fertility. Many of the plants would no longer be pollinated. Lots of animals, amphibians, reptiles, birds, mammals would have nothing to eat. And our fields and pastures would be covered with dung and carrion. These small creatures are within...

Harpy eagles are the most powerful birds of prey in the world. Standing three feet tall, with a six-foot wingspan and razor-sharp talons the size of bear claws, these birds are the heavyweight hunters of the South American rainforest. But scientists know very little about harpy eagles because their numbers are few, their habitat is large, they never soar above the trees, and they rarely come to the ground.
